What are you called if you’re from Indiana?

For well over a century and a half the people of Indiana have been called Hoosiers. It is one of the oldest of state nicknames and has had a wider acceptance than most.

How many presidents are from Indiana?

While only one president, Benjamin Harrison, has been affiliated with Indiana, the state has played an important role in presidential elections frequently in our nation’s history.

Is Axl Rose from Indiana?

Axl Rose was born William Bruce Rose Jr. in Lafayette, Indiana, the oldest child of Sharon Elizabeth (née Lintner), then 16 years old and still in high school, and William Bruce Rose, then 20 years old.

What is Gary in famous for?

Gary was named after lawyer Elbert Henry Gary, who was the founding chairman of the United States Steel Corporation….
